The Omnia does not have the necessary hardware to render the 3D carousel.

To get the fancy SMS page you need to tap and hold on the icon. Choose default action and then select open 3D viewer. It will then look like that. You need to do the same thing for email if you want to use the 3D email.

It's a bug, guys. Relax. Bugs are an unavoidable aspect of software. These things will be fixed in the next release.

There's an enormous difference between a bug that amounts to an annoyance, and one that has no workaround and makes the product unusable. There are a variety of ways to just as easily access the reply feature in messaging (as have been cited here), so arguably the broken Reply button is nothing more than an asthetic issue. Hardly something to condemn the product over.

MS3.5 is a nice step forward from 3.0.1. MS3 is, IMO, well worth the money, and the upgrade to 3.5 is worthwhile too, if for nothing more than the added widgets and improved customization interface.

Judging by SPB's past behavior, I expect we'll see a 3.5.1 pretty soon (within 60 days or so of the 3.5 release) fixing these bugs.

does anyone know how to change the clock not to show PM/AM but European style - for example 18:00 not 6:00 PM?

You don't do this in MS. You'll do this in Settings/System/Regional. There you define both time and date format. SPB should adopt these... at least it always has for me. :D
